Top Picks for Mid-Range Smartwatches
1. Redmi Watch 3 Active
The Redmi Watch 3 Active from Xiaomi comes in at just under €40, while definitely a beautiful timepiece with premium design and the display that doesn’t fade at different brightness levels. Most significantly, it has a microphone and speaker for calling, making it amongst the cheapest with such capability. Add to that two weeks of battery life, and this becomes the prime choice for whomever is thinking of purchasing a quality good-priced smartwatch.
2. Xiaomi Redmi Watch 4
Those looking for something extra may opt for Xiaomi Redmi Watch 4, priced at around €100. It has a luxurious AMOLED screen and a huge battery life span that can stretch for almost three weeks. Well, it is also 5ATM water-resistant, hosts phone call handling, and carries 150 different sports modes with aluminum built to fit the fitness needs of a new feel of sportiness or those born with a taste for durability and elegance.
3. Huawei Watch Fit 2
The expertise in smartwatches really stands out when it comes to Huawei. Their design is very appealing, done around a rectangular AMOLED screen, for only €69. The interface has been finely worked, as everything Huawei does. While the battery life of the Smart Watch can’t compare to some of the others on this list, it does come with a pretty comprehensive set of features.
4. Amazfit Bip 5
Starting at €75, the Amazfit Bip 5 goes head-to-head with the Redmi Watch 3 Active at that price point. The device is supported by a 1-month battery life in battery saver mode and has GPS to support location tracking. It also features Alexa for voice commands and supports Bluetooth calling, really being a very good all-rounder, unless the screen bezels put you off.
5. Amazfit GTS 4 Mini
Another interesting proposal is the Amazfit GTS 4 Mini, at €67, with a really beautiful AMOLED display. This keeps the watch design very close to the Apple Watch design; the offer is quite attractive for those looking for a similar look but at a cheaper price. It will also host built-in GPS and health tracking features but without call answering support.
